Titel | The Ice Cream Stories: A Study in Normal and Psychotic Narrations. |
Quelle | In: Discourse Processes, 9 (1986) 3, S.305-28 |
Sprache | englisch |
Dokumenttyp | gedruckt; Zeitschriftenaufsatz |
Schlagwörter | Communication Research; Concept Formation; Discourse Analysis; Encoding (Psychology); Language Processing; Narration; Perception; Psychological Patterns; Psychosis; Story Telling |
Abstract | Indicates that the psychotic and normal populations showed definable differences in encoding strategies when presented with an adaption of the Pear Stories study. Supports theories claiming that faulty filtering mechanisms, vulnerability to distraction, and attentional deficits account for psychotic subjects' reactions. (JD) |
